Biography

Norman Westhoff is a retired physician and a geography buff. The "Erebus Tales" trilogy mark his first published fiction, and sprang from a lifetime of travel and immersion in many different cultures, on six continents. He earned a Public Health degree, and used it to help improve medical care in Dmitrov, Russia. He plays concertina and accordion at traditional music sessions. He has climbed Mt. Kilimanjaro and trekked to Everest base camp and the Camino de Santiago. He and his wife have been active in their co-housing community in Lawrence KS. They have three children and five grandchildren, all avid readers.

Stone Fever: Erebus Tales, Book I

Radical climate change has reshaped human geography by the 24th century. Geologist Keltyn SparrowHawk flies to ice-free Antarctica to scout for iridium, but finds a nomad tribe. She befriends young Luz, also searching for the iris stone, from which her mother makes jewelry. Despite warnings, they climb a nearby volcano to find the stone, but mortal perils await on the mountain and with the tribe.
